A High-Level Framework vs. Low-Level Specification: A In-Depth Comparison

Understanding the distinction between high-level and low-level design is vital for effective software development. High-Level design, also called architectural design, focuses on the overall structure of the project. It defines the key components, their interactions , and the broad flow of data . Think of it as creating the floor plan of a building – you see the rooms and their location, but not necessarily the specific plumbing or wiring details. In contrast , low-level design delves into the details of how each component is built . This involves choosing algorithms, data structures, and interface methods. It's the like detailing the internal mechanisms in that same more info house , ensuring each element functions correctly . Essentially , high-level design provides the "what" and "why," while low-level design addresses the "how."

  • High-Level Design: Concerns conceptual structure
  • Low-Level Design: Concerns granular specifics
  • Both levels are crucial for a complete development process .
